Departamento de Informática (UM)

Página de Unidade Curricular

DesignaçãoCódigoCursoRegimeRegente

Recuperação de Informação

14906 [ME81ME8100005431]

Mestrado em Engenharia de Telecomunicações e Informática [METI]

S2

Joaquim Melo Henriques Macedo

Objetivos

O programa do curso começa dando uma formação adequada para a apreensão dos conhecimentos fundamentais de processamento e recuperação da informação em geral, e da recuperação da Web em particular. Os alunos obtêm a capacidade de fazer a comparação dos vários modelos de recuperação de informação utilizados e avaliar a sua adequação a diferentes contextos.
A avaliação da eficácia de recuperação de vários motores de busca é apresentados tanto no ponto de vista teórico, como prático.

Programa

1. Introdução à Recuperação de Informação: termos e listas de ocorrências
2. Construção e compressão de índices
3. Modelos de Recuperação de Informação: booleano, vectorial, probabilístico
4. Avaliação de Sistemas de Recuperação de Informação
5. Expansão de interrogações e realimentação de relevância
6. Classificação e Aglomeração de documentos
7. Indexação por semântica latente
8. Aprendizagem para ranking
9. Recuperação de Informação na Web
10. Análise de Ligações

Bibliografia

Manning, C. D., Raghavan, P., Schütze, H. (2008). Introduction to Information Retrieval. Cambridge University Press

Modern Information Retrieval, by Baeza-Yates and Ribeiro-Neto, Addison Wesley, 2011

Information Retrieval: Implementing and Evaluating Search Engines , by Stefan Büttcher , Charles L. A. Clarke), Gordon V. Cormack, The MIT Press, February 12, 2016

Machine Learning for Text, by Charu C. Aggarwal , Mar 20, 2018

Papers from the following Conferences and Journals: ACM SIGIR, ECIR, NLPIR, ECNLPIR, SCIENTOMETRIC(s)

Nota: Alguns livros aqui indicados são um pouco antigos mas são os mais usados nas Universidades de referência. Algum algoritmo ou abordagem mais recente pode ser introduzido pelo docente indicando o artigo científico correspondente

Resultados da aprendizagem

O estudante, no final da sua aprendizagem nesta Unidade Curricular, deve ser capaz de:

- Definir necessidades de informação de várias partes interessadas no contexto da Engenharia Informática e do utilizador em genérico
- Relacionar as várias necessidades de informação como interrogações
- Identificar fontes de informação relevantes
- Explicitar as necessidades de informação como interrogações para cada fonte de informação
- Relacionar modelos, métodos e ferramentas para processamento e recuperação de informação
- Implementar métodos para o desenvolvimento e avaliação de ferramentas de processamento e recuperação de informação
- Avaliar a eficácia das ferramentas para processar e recuperar informações e a importância das fontes de informação.

Método de avaliação

Avaliação individual: 2 frequências; Realização de Exercícios teorico-práticos na sala de aula e em casa; Pesos relativos para esta componente: 40% a 45% cada frequência e 10% a 20% exercícios na sala de aula e em casa.
Avaliação em grupo: 1 Pequeno Projeto de Desenvolvimento com Relatório Escrito e Apresentação Oral. Será dada bastante atenção ao código de conduta dos estudantes na realização do seu trabalho.
Classificação final: 40% a 50% Avaliação Individual e 50% a 60% Avaliação em grupo (Projeto).

Funcionamento

Turno: T 1; Docente: Joaquim Melo Henriques Macedo; Dep.: DI; Horas: 15.
Turno: TP 1; Docente: Joaquim Melo Henriques Macedo; Dep.: DI; Horas: 30.

[ Outras UCs do Departamento ]